Footpad lesions are a true marker of broiler welfare and an increasingly important part of global processing regulations. This module eliminates laborious random feet checks, and instead automates a near-perfect process not influenced by human factors.
Footpad lesions are automatically detected through digital imagery and is graded into one of three categories, according to the Swedish Animal Welfare scored, based on color and lesion size. For each flock, the percentage per class is calculated and registered. Flock scores are collated and put into a database and reports. These reports serve as feedback for the farmers to ultimately improve animal welfare. Healthier birds make produce better yield.
